SRES 98 · 96th Congress · Energy
A resolution expressing the sense of the Senate that the President should withdraw and amend the Standby Gasoline Rationing Program.

Expresses the sense of the Senate that the President should withdraw the standby gasoline rationing plan submitted to Congress on March 1, 1979, and resubmit an amended plan to remedy interstate inequities with regard to gasoline rationing coupon distribution.…
